Stay near popular Rockland attractions

Learn more about Rockland

Lobster lovers flock to this coastal gem for fresh-off-the-boat feasts and the Maine Lobster Festival each August. Art enthusiasts can explore the Farnsworth Art Museum's collection of American masterpieces, then hop aboard a windjammer for a scenic sail along Penobscot Bay.

Where to stay near Rockland

Rockland, Maine, offers a delightful blend of outdoor adventures and scenic beauty perfect for any traveller. Explore the charming downtown area, where friendly locals and rich history create a welcoming atmosphere. Enjoy stunning water views and vibrant city vibes as you indulge in local cuisine and unique shops. Nearby regions provide additional opportunities for family-friendly excursions, making Rockland an ideal vacation spot for those seeking both relaxation and adventure.

  • Camden: Nestled 12.9km from Rockland, Camden is a picturesque coastal town known for its stunning outdoor scenery and adventure opportunities. This charming city attracts seasonal visitors, particularly from July to September, who flock to enjoy the hiking trails and pristine golf courses. Highlights include the nearby Camden Hills State Park, offering panoramic views, and the serene Lake Megunticook, perfect for kayaking and picnicking. Whether you’re seeking an exhilarating hike or a leisurely day by the lake, Camden provides a delightful escape into nature.
  • Rockport: Located a mere 9.7km from Rockland, Rockport is a quaint town that embodies Maine’s coastal charm. With a moderately seasonal influx of tourists peaking from June to August, visitors are drawn to its scenic landscapes and outdoor activities. Explore the local hiking trails or play a round of golf at one of the area’s beautiful courses. Nearby landmarks such as the stunning Rockport Harbor and the scenic Camden Hills National Park enhance the experience, making it a perfect spot for those looking to immerse themselves in Maine's natural beauty.
  • Owls Head: Just 4.8km from Rockland, Owls Head is a hidden gem that perfectly captures the essence of coastal Maine. This small city experiences seasonal tourism with peak visits from June to August. Visitors come for the breathtaking scenery and outdoor adventures, with opportunities for hiking and exploring recreational areas. The nearby Owls Head Lighthouse offers stunning views of the coastline, while the adjacent state parks provide excellent hiking trails. Whether you’re enjoying a peaceful day at the beach or exploring the rugged coastline, Owls Head is a must-visit destination.

Shopping

Your shopping experience in Rockland begins at the Maine State Prison Store, only 6.4km away, offering unique gifts. If you're up for a drive, check out the Damariscotta Farmer's Market, 32.2km away, for local produce and crafts, or visit Windsor Chairmakers, located 16.4km from Rockland.

Recreation

At Samoset Resort Golf Course, enjoy a scenic round of golf with breathtaking coastal views, perfect for relaxation and outdoor fun. Golfer's Crossing Mini Golf offers a family-friendly adventure with creatively themed holes. For tranquility, visit Pemaquid Point Lighthouse Park, where you can unwind amidst stunning ocean landscapes.

Adventure

Experience thrilling skiing at Camden Snow Bowl, located 12.9km from Rockland, where you can enjoy scenic slopes and vibrant sports vibes. For a peaceful outdoor adventure, hike the Dyce Head Foot Path, 38.6km away, or explore the White Head Trail, 41.8km from Rockland, for stunning views and nature exploration.

Nightlife

Experience the vibrant nightlife in Rockland by catching a show at the Strand Theater, perfect for culture and romance. For some adventure, visit the Oakland Park Bowling Lanes, just 6.4km away. Don’t miss the Camden Harbor Park and Amphitheatre, 12.9km out, for more entertainment options.

The nearest major airports for your trip to Rockland

When visiting Rockland, Maine, you can fly into several major airports. Bangor International Airport (BGR) is situated 82.1km away, with nearby accommodation options like the Quality Inn Bangor Airport, only 1.6km from the terminal, and Bangor Aviator Hotel at the airport's doorstep. Bar Harbor Airport (BHB) is 70.8km away, with notable stays like the Cleftstone Inn, 12.9km from the airport. Augusta State Airport (AUG) is the closest at 59.5km, featuring hotels such as Senator Inn & Spa just 966m away. Each airport offers convenient transportation services to ensure a smooth transition to your destination.

What is the best area to stay in Rockland?
The best area to stay in Rockland is the downtown area, particularly along Main Street and its immediate surroundings.

This central district is very walkable and offers direct access to the harbour. Main Street itself is lined with art galleries, independent shops, and a variety of restaurants, making it a convenient base for exploring. You'll find many of Rockland's key attractions, such as the Farnsworth Art Museum and the Maine Lighthouse Museum, within easy reach.

For couples looking for a sophisticated and convenient stay, downtown Rockland is an excellent choice. You can enjoy strolls along the waterfront, dine at acclaimed restaurants, and easily visit cultural institutions. Many accommodations in this area offer sea views or are just a short walk to the harbour.

Solo travellers will also appreciate the downtown area for its accessibility and variety of things to do.
